Iʻve been customizing my network and in the process I stylized the Ning bar. How do I now delete the blue line at the top of my network page (red arrow is pointing to it in my screenshot below) that originally separated the Ning bar from my banner/header?

Permalink Reply by dave on November 16, 2012 at 2:29am Or you could just add this to you css
#xg_themebody {
border-top: 3px solid #ffffff;
}
Permalink Reply by Kit Wynkoop on November 16, 2012 at 2:56pm Mahalo Nui, Dave - that did the trick!
